Job Summary
Under general direction, is responsible for performing specialized work at a City building or other public sites to include the maintenance of equipment and repair and/or physical operation of City buildings including cleaning and setting for events. May exercise functional supervision over assigned staff. Work Location
Henry B. Gonzalez Convention Center - 900 E. Market Street, San Antonio, TX 78205 Work Schedule
- 5:30 AM - 4:00 PM OR 12:00 PM - 10:30 PM (4 days per week, 10 hour shifts)
- Hours and shift may vary based on department needs
- Weekends, holidays and extended hours as needed
- Supervises and assists as necessary in various aspects of trades maintenance (i.e. carpentry, electrical, plumbing, etc.) and directs work activities.
- Participates in the repair of equipment and facilities, which may include frequently lifting and carrying equipment and parts weighing up to 50 pounds.
- Monitors and coordinates the work of Service Contract Surveyors.
- Supervises, assigns and reviews work of staff; sets performance standards and evaluates staff; reviews performance evaluations prepared by subordinate supervisors; trains, counsels and disciplines staff; conducts interviews and selects staff to be hired; directs work activities of staff responsible for custodial care and setup of City Facilities for events.
- Utilizes tools and equipment while conducting site inspections of equipment and facilities to determine the need for maintenance or to check work in progress.
- Coordinates preventive maintenance programs and equipment repair.
- Plans short term (weekly or daily) work activities or schedules based on supervisor's or customer's instructions.
- Coordinates and supervises work programs for unskilled and semi-skilled personnel.
- Investigates and analyzes personnel issues; prepares and compiles written reports to Manager with recommended solutions.
- Investigates employee accidents, prepares appropriate reports; identifies and resolves safety hazards for staff.
- Develops programs and maintains awareness of safety and accident prevention.
- Keeps personnel maintenance records and time system information.
- Orders custodial and maintenance supplies and keeps supply records.
- Transports employees and/or equipment to other locations within the department and/or to other facilities within the City.
- Performs related duties and fulfills responsibilities as required.
- High school diploma or GED equivalent (recognized by the Texas Education Agency or a regional accrediting agency).
- Four (4) years of experience in building/facilities maintenance, including two (2) years of supervisory or management experience.
- Valid Class "C" Texas Driver's License.
- Experiences with custodial equipment, custodial services and cleaning procedures
- Experience with setting up for large events
- Experience with reading setups and diagrams
- Unless otherwise stated, applicants are permitted to substitute two years of related full-time experience for one year of higher education or one year of related higher education for two years of experience in order to meet the minimum requirements of the job. One year of full-time experience is defined as 30 or more hours worked per week for 12 months. One year of higher education is defined as 30 credit hours completed at an accredited college or university.
- Applicants selected for employment with the City of San Antonio in this position must receive satisfactory results from pre-employment drug testing and background checks. If required for the position, a physical, motor vehicle record evaluation, and additional background checks may be conducted.
- Please be advised that if selected for this position, information regarding employment history as it relates to the qualifications of the position will be needed for employment verification. Applicants claiming military service to meet the experience requirement for this position may attach a DD214 to the application.
- If selected for this position, official transcripts, diplomas, certifications, and licenses must be submitted at the time of processing. Unofficial transcripts and copies of other relevant documents may be attached to the application for consideration in advance.
- Knowledge of principles of supervision, training and performance evaluation.
- Knowledge of a variety of tools, machinery, equipment, and materials related to the building maintenance trade and physical operation of buildings.
- Knowledge of code requirements, techniques, and practices in masonry, carpentry, plumbing, electrical, and tile work.
- Knowledge of paint and varnish application techniques.
- Knowledge of safety measures, as they apply to the building maintenance trade or operation of a facility.
- Knowledge of various scheduling techniques including event-based scheduling
- Skill in operating all tools and equipment used in the building maintenance trade or operations associated with custodial work or setting of equipment.
- Ability to communicate clearly and effectively.
-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with co-workers, supervisors, and the general public.
- Ability to interpret and apply any applicable codes, ordinances and departmental and City policies and procedures.
- Ability to schedule and direct staff based on customer requirements.
- Ability to assign, review and evaluate work.
- Ability to organize work and set priorities to meet deadlines.
- Ability to perform all the physical requirements of the position, with or without accommodations.
- Working conditions are both indoors and outdoors, with occasional exposure to temperature extremes, dust, dirt, grease, loud noises, flammable liquids, or hazardous fumes.
